Glamorgan take control of their match against Surrey as Mason Crane and Tom Norton produce standout performances. Crane records a maiden century, giving Glamorgan a strong platform, while Norton secures his maiden five-wicket haul to dismantle Surrey’s batting. With Glamorgan’s bowling and batting impact combining to limit Surrey’s total, Surrey are forced to follow on.
